MICHELLE MANIA is a founding member of the Pasadena Shakespeare Company. Some of her past credits include Juliet in "Romeo & Juliet," Hero in "Much Ado about Nothing," Duckling Smith in "Our Country's Good," Jenny Diver in "The Beggar's Opera," and Carol Donovan in "Pearls and Marlowe." She was recently seen at The Raven Playhouse in a production of Neil Simon's "California Suite" as Diana Nichols and will soon be seen as the abused mother in the feature film "Half Way." She is also a proud graduate of the performing arts program at Hollywood High-school under the direction of Mr. Jerry Melton. In 1986 her life took a turn when a friend encouraged her to spend her summer as a camp counselor working with developmentally disabled adults. She began working at the Tierra del Sol Foundation in 1991. Tierra del Sol is a well respected non profit organization that facilitates independence in adults with disabilities. After 15 years of working at Tierra, Michelle has decided to step down as the Artistic Director of the Tierra Players to pursue her first love of acting and spend more time with her 2 children Matthew aged 5 and Madalyn aged 3. During her tenure at Tierra she wrote, produced, and directed many original works. . It was amazing to witness the growth and change in her students over the years at Tierra. On a personal note, Michelle has been married for 6 years to Matt Mania who is a DP in the film industry.
